For the 2025-26 school year, there is 1 public school serving 1,427 students in Bucks County Technical High School District. This district's average testing ranking is 3/10, which is in the bottom 50% of public schools in Pennsylvania.
51爆料 in Bucks County Technical High School District have an average math proficiency score of 11% (versus the Pennsylvania public school average of 38%), and reading proficiency score of 50% (versus the 55% statewide average).
Minority enrollment is 27%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is less than the Pennsylvania public school average of 39% (majority Hispanic and Black).

District Revenue and Spending
The revenue/student of $7,618 in this school district is less than the state median of $23,696. The school district revenue/student has stayed relatively flat over four school years.
The school district's spending/student of $7,055 is less than the state median of $23,119.  The school district spending/student has stayed relatively flat over four school years.
